Windows 2008 R2 64-Bit CPU: Intel Core i5 - 4 cores RAM: 8 GB Apache 2.2 PHP 5.3.1 WebMay 3, 2016 · The first rule of configuring MySQL memory usage is you never want your MySQL to cause the operating system to swap. Even minor swapping activity can dramatically reduce MySQL performance. Note the keyword “activity” here. MySQL allocates buffers and caches to improve performance of database operations. The default configuration is designed to permit a MySQL server to start on a virtual machine that has approximately 512MB of RAM.
